Official abstract text for this publication.
A carrier adjustment assembly for coupling to a frame member of an implement includes a laterally adjustable carrier configured to be coupled to an opener and a first outlet providing at least one nutrient. The assembly further includes a plurality of lateral spacers positioned adjacent to the carrier to laterally adjust the carrier and provide a plurality of adjustment positions. The carrier adjustment assembly facilitates lateral adjustment of the carrier by removal of at least one captively held lateral spacer that sets the lateral adjustment of the carrier, a lateral adjustment of the first outlet, and an adjustment of a lateral separation between a seed row provided by a second outlet and a nutrient row provided by the first outlet.
